Transaction af83d3224fd910ae457dfea024460d9683eb050efebffc4822209846ed07778e

1 Input
2 Outputs
  • af83d3224fd910ae457dfea024460d9683eb050efebffc4822209846ed07778e:0
  • value  50190069
    address  3NHZ3LXYyrn3r3XqHYZsAhedBBjeCFj7Ka
  • af83d3224fd910ae457dfea024460d9683eb050efebffc4822209846ed07778e:1
  • value  30000000
    address  3JdpTWsGDZrfqdiRNbuGwW1mXnJKqgSy49